P
arameter
Types
SCPI
denes
dierent
data
formats
for
use
in
program
message
and
query
responses
.
The
4263B
accepts
commands
and
parameters
in
various
formats
and
responds
to
a
particular
query
in
a
predened
and
xed
format.
Each
command
reference
contains
in
formation
about
the
parameter
types
available
for
the
individual
commands
.
<numeric
value>
is
used
in
both
common
commands
and
subsystem
commands
.
<numeric
value>
represents
numeric
parameters
as
follows:
l00
no
decimal
point
required
l00.
fractional
digits
optional
-1.23,+235
leading
signs
allowed
4.56et 3
space
allowedafter
e
in
exponentials
-7.89E-01
use
either
E
or
e
in
exponentials
.5
digits
left
of
decimal
point
optional
The
4263B
setting
programmed
with
a
numeric
parameter
can
assume
a
nite
number
of
values
,
so
the
4263B
automatically
rounds
o
the
parameter
.
F
or
example
,
the
4263B
has
a
programmable
power
line
frequency
of
50
or
60
Hz.
If
you
specied
50.1,
it
would
be
rounded
o
to
50.
The
subsystem
commands
can
use
extended
numeric
parameters
.
Extended
numeric
parameters
accept
all
numeric
parameter
values
and
other
special
values
,
for
instance
,
MAXimum,
MINimum,
or
UP
,
DOWN.
The
special
values
available
are
described
in
the
command's
reference
description.
Query
response
of
<numeric
value>
is
always
a
numeric
value
.
<Boolean>
represents
a
single
binary
condition
that
is
either
ON
or
OFF
.
<Boolean>
allows
the
following
parameters:
ON,
OFF
In
a
program
message
1,
0
In
a
program
message
and
query
response
<sensor
function>
and
<data
handle>
are
string
parameter
which
contain
ASCII
characters
.
A
string
must
begin
with
a
single
quote
(ASCII
39
decimal)
or
a
double
quote
(ASCII
34
decimal)
and
end
with
the
same
corresponding
character
,
a
single
or
double
quote
.
The
quote
to
mark
the
beginning
and
end
of
the
string
is
called
the
delimiter
.
Y
ou
can
include
the
delimiter
as
part
of
the
string
by
typing
it
twice
without
any
characters
in
between.
Example
of
<sensor
function>
'FIMP',
l0
OUTPUT
@Meter;":FUNC
'FIMP'"
using
single
quote
20
OUTPUT
@Meter;":FUNC
""FIMP"""
using
double
quote
The
query
response
is
the
string
between
double
quote
delimiters
.
Units
Units
can
be
used
with
numeric
value
parameters
when
so
documented
in
the
Command
Reference
.
